Our news has just shown the massive evacuation of the city. It's somehow impersonal, a movie, a thing happening far away.
Obviously it's not a movie. Obviously there are many highly nervous folk there in real life dramas. Equally obviously there will be looting. But this time one hopes that any death toll will be minimal.
In a bizarre way one hopes that the storm will be bad enough to justify the evacuation. If it is not, will folk take notice of the next one?
Do we know anyone in the affected area?
